												چکیده انگلیسی
												The Pierre Auger Observatory studies ultra-high energy cosmic rays in the range of 1018eV up to the highest energies. The apparatus reaches full sensitivity above 1019ev. The southern hemisphere site is currently under construction. When completed, the surface array at this site will contain 1600 water Cherenkov detector stations distributed over 3000km2. Prior to proceeding with full-scale construction, a prototype “Engineering Array”, consisting of 40 detector stations was tested. This paper describes the implementation of the first level surface detector trigger used in the engineering array.
